Superior semicircular canal dehiscence syndrome: Often a missing clinical entity in vertigo management
Superior semicircular canal dehiscence syndrome (SSCDS) is a rare and recently described inner ear lesion presenting with disequilibrium and associated with dehiscence of the bony covering of SSC.
